    Set along this storied block of P Street—one of only two West Village streets, along with O Street, where original trolley rails still run through the old brick roadway—this historic, standalone residence is a rare find. Built in 1885, and recently renovated throughout, the Victorian home combines timeless architectural character with sophisticated modern upgrades across approximately 3,855 square feet of refined interior living. The property boasts 5 bed, 5.5 bath and garage parking, plus exceptional privacy and outdoor space. An extensive renovation completed in 2019 elevated both functionality and design throughout the home. The expanded gourmet kitchen features top-of-the-line appliances, custom cabinetry, and premium finishes. Southern-facing windows are outfitted with app-controlled The Shade Store motorized blinds, offering seamless light and privacy control. Glass flooring offers ample light to the lower level office. The renovation added a full bath on the second level, enhancing livability, while the lower level offers a sun-filled office or flex space with radiant heated floors, along with additional storage and a new laundry room. Throughout the home, solid plantation shutters, hardwood floors, and preserved historic details reflect classic Georgetown craftsmanship. Modern infrastructure upgrades include a leak defense monitoring system designed to protect against water system issues, providing peace of mind. Outdoor living is complemented by a charming rear patio with new stonework and custom water feature. The detached parking is a rare feature in this premier location.
